Nurture Teacher – Sunderland

The Education Network are currently recruiting for a dedicated and resilient Nurture Teacher to work within a specialist provision in the Sunderland area. This is a long‑term opportunity, working with secondary‑aged pupils who are working below expected levels for their age.

The Role

  • Full‑time position, Monday to Friday
  • Working hours: 8:30am – 4:30pm (early finish on Fridays: 8:30am – 3:30pm)
  • Long‑term placement teaching secondary‑aged students with additional learning and emotional needs
  • Delivering tailored lessons to meet individual learning levels
  • Supporting pupils with engagement, behaviour and emotional regulation

Requirements

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) is essential
  • Experience working within SEN, nurture groups, alternative provision or behavioural settings is desirable
  • Strong behaviour‑management and relationship‑building skills
  • A patient, adaptable and nurturing approach
  • Ability to differentiate learning for students working below age‑related expectations
